WebEach state sets a limit on the amount of time you have to file a lawsuit in civil court after an injury. In Indiana this time limit (known as the "statute of limitations") is two years. Usually, this two-year time limit starts running on the date of the accident. WebThe statute of limitations refers to the time you have to file a personal injury lawsuit. WebFor Indiana advisory rates effective 1/1/2024, the State Per Claim Accident Limitation is $196,000 and the Employers Liability Accident Limitation is $55,000. In most states, …

WebStandard Limits of Liability, Per Accident. The standard EL limits are not found in the statute itself, but are contained in the Basic Manual for Workers Compensation & Employers Liability Insurance – 2024 Edition. This manual and its rules are filed with and approved for use by the Indiana Department of Insurance.
